Doug Slaten of the 2009 Arizona Diamondbacks had the 5th-lowest salary ($422K) of the 46 left-handers who played in Chase Field.
surpassed himself of the 2007 Arizona Diamondbacks ($380K), Jordan Norberto of the 2010 Arizona Diamondbacks ($400K), himself of the 2008 Arizona Diamondbacks ($400K), and Joe Paterson of the 2011 Arizona Diamondbacks ($414K).
